Diesel Brothers

12:00 PM to 1:00 PM
Wednesday 4 February
+

Failure To Launch

Season 2 Episode 11 of 20

Heavy D continues trying to salvage a wrecked overland camper from Europe, hoping for a big payday. Meanwhile, Sam designs a diesel-powered bicycle

Diesel Brothers airs on Discovery Channel HD at 12:00 PM, Wednesday 4 February. (Subtitles.)
Topics
News ➝ Current Affairs
Documentary